Output b7835de6bbeba5b908e3e418681bf254e99ab8d62db406159577ab8bcfa0daad:96

value
65805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c969d9ef655685ed20105ee9a4aac143fc5279e4 OP_EQUAL
address
3L3zYnAhqTaJBmy44cS1n1K89xTkNPhD87
transaction
b7835de6bbeba5b908e3e418681bf254e99ab8d62db406159577ab8bcfa0daad
confirmations
173785
spent
true